## Canary Gating Approvals

All changes to Briarhelm's canary gating rules require documented approval before merge. Gating thresholds (error rate, latency, saturation) are security-relevant because relaxed gates can promote compromised builds. Reviewers must confirm the change record includes rationale, rollback steps, and an audit entry in Vanewick. Final authority for approving gating-rule modifications rests with the individual named below.

named custodian: Oliath Ralax

# Runbook: Hunting leaked file descriptors in Quillgate

When the `fd_open` gauge climbs steadily between deploys, suspect a leak rather than load. First confirm on a single pod: exec in and count entries under `/proc/1/fd`, noting how many are sockets in CLOSE_WAIT versus regular files. Capture two snapshots ten minutes apart before restarting anything — we need the delta for the postmortem. Reproduce locally with the Marbury load harness, which requires the service running with the following configuration values.

settings of yagep-bajog:
[istdor]
port = 4000
region = south-2
host = istdor.qorvelcorp.internal
timeout_ms = 5000
retries = 5

**Vendor note: Inkmill markdown pipeline**

Rendering for Parchway docs is outsourced to Inkmill under an annual contract, renewing each March. They handle sanitization and PDF export; we own the upload queue. SLA: 4-hour response on rendering failures. Escalate only after two failed retries. Their support desk is reachable at the address below.

billing contact of hahaf-baguf = zorael.tammir.jorius@sivrelhq.internal